June 10th, 2021 Snowfall Gallery

Snow continued falling yesterday in the resorts, heaviest falls in the north where Perisher, Thredbo and Charlotte Pass picked up another 50-60cm, Falls Creek around 17cm, Hotham a bit less and unfortunately it warmed up in the south and Mt Buller and Baw Baw had their new snow washed away by rain.

Digital annual passes for Kosciuszko National Park make snow season easy

NSW National Parks and Wildlife Service (NPWS) is making the snow season easier for visitors with new digital annual pass entry to Kosciuszko National Park.
For the first time, when visitors buy a new digital annual pass from the NPWS website before leaving home, it will be automatically linked to their vehicle registration and ready to use straight away.

Australia’s oldest Olympian honoured on his 99th Birthday at Thredbo

When ‘The Tors’ run was re-named Frank’s Face at Thredbo today, it is in honour of Thredbo resident and Australia’s oldest living Olympian Frank Prihoda as he celebrates his 99th birthday. But this is just the ski tip of an incredible story.
